Computer Vision Systems Developer
Type: [Full-Time]
Your Mission
As a Computer Vision Systems Developer, you will be the critical link between AI research and real-world hardware. You won't just train models; you will make them run blazingly fast in production. Your primary focus will be optimizing, deploying, and maintaining robust vision pipelines on [edge devices / cloud infrastructure / robotic platforms] to ensure our systems operate flawlessly in real-time.
The Tech Stack
- Languages: Python, modern C++ (C++14+)
- Frameworks: PyTorch or TensorFlow, OpenCV
- Deployment & Optimization: TensorRT, ONNX, OpenVINO, CUDA
- Infrastructure: Linux, Docker, [GStreamer / V4L2], [AWS/GCP]
- Hardware: NVIDIA Jetson, Edge TPUs, RGB/Depth Cameras, LiDAR
The Day-to-Day
- Build the Pipeline: Architect and maintain end-to-end computer vision workflows, from camera sensor acquisition to model inference and post-processing.
- Squeeze Out Performance: Profile code and optimize deep learning models (quantization, pruning) to hit strict real-time latency and FPS targets on constrained hardware.
- Integrate Software & Hardware: Seamlessly connect vision algorithms with external sensors, edge compute boards, and broader system architecture.
- Write Production Code: Deliver clean, thread-safe,
and highly efficient C++ and Python code.
- Monitor & Iterate: Build automated CI/CD pipelines to test vision models, track data drift in the wild, and push over-the-air (OTA) updates.
- Collaborate: Work hand-in-hand with Data Scientists to inform model architecture decisions based on actual hardware limits.
What You Bring
- 3+ years of skilled software engineering experience with a heavy focus on computer vision and ML deployment.
- Deep expertise in writing production-ready C++ and Python.
- Proven hands-on experience optimizing models using tools like TensorRT, ONNX, or CUDA.
- A strong grasp of multi-threading, memory management, and concurrent programming in Linux environments.
- A degree (BS, MS, or Ph.D.) in Computer Science, Robotics, Electrical Engineering, or a related field.
Bonus Points
- You have successfully deployed ML models onto edge devices (NVIDIA Jetson, Coral, Raspberry Pi).
- You have experience with 3D computer vision, point clouds, or SLAM.
- You know your way around camera hardware, ISP tuning, and video streaming protocols (GStreamer).
